Contractors patronized by BJP ‘stop’ contractor from submitting tender

From a Correspondent
GAON (HAIBORGAON), March 19: Sensation prevailed in gaon town on Saturday noon following an incident that took place at the premise of the office of the Superintendent Engineer, PWD (road), gaon, circle in which some contractors patronized by the ruling party BJP allegedly stopped a contractor from submitting his tender papers and also allegedly assaulted and dragged him out of the office premise.  Later, following the incident, the higher authority of the office had to call the magistrate and other security personnel to bring the situation under control. According to the sources, the PWD (road) circle asked tender papers for repair and renovation of various roads of the district and Saturday was the last date for submitting the tender papers. One contractor of Samaguri LAC med Pradip Bora along with other contractors went to the office to drop his tender papers for a particular road. But before submitting his papers, some local contractors who are allegedly patronized by the ruling party, stopped him and tried to assault him and also dragged him out from the office premise. The sources added that the attackers alleged that the victim contractor was a close associate of former minister Rokibul Hussain and hence they did not let him drop his tender documents for that particular road.
